What affects the price

Landscaping costs depend on the specific needs of your property. Factors that shift the price include the square footage of the area, the complexity of your design, and the type of materials you choose, such as natural stone versus concrete pavers. Labor costs fluctuate based on site accessibility and the amount of grading or drainage work required before planting begins.

About this service

This refers to the various types of rocks and pavers used to elevate the aesthetic of your lawn. You need stones when you want to define garden edges, create a fire pit area, or build a walkway. What is the least expensive way to landscape?

The least expensive way to landscape often involves starting with basic lawn care, adding mulch, and planting hardy, fast-growing perennials. You can also focus on DIY projects for smaller tasks.
